I won't run out of it anytime soon, I just wanted to share my thoughts so far, cause I have been using it for 2-3 months now. I will be talking about Scinic AquaEX gel eye cream. Scinic is a korean brand, and this is the first product I try from this brand.

 I decided to try this because it's a plain eye moisturizer. That means it doesn't have any special properties such as firming, fine line reducing etc etc. I have seen products of this brand being used in several korean beauty TV shows, so that kinda made me trust the brand, although I had never heard of it before.


This cream has a gel consistency which makes it easy to glide and spread. It smells fresh, an ocean breeze type of smell I'd say. It's white and has medium thickness, It's not runny, but definitely not too thick either. I bought it from Ebay, for 9euros (~11$)/ 30ml which I think was a really good price, if we consider that eye creams are usually kinda expensive.


At first I liked the way it felt in my skin, I don't have dry eye area, so this cream was super nice and light on me. I kept patting and patting for several minutes though for it to sink in. And that is probably my only complain. It goes really sticky after sometime, so I have to leave it alone to sink in by itself. It is really annoying, since I do not like waiting for creams to sink in. Nonetheless, it doesn't leave any residue, it doesnt get greasy or anything else, and it leaves the eyes pleasantly moisturized. You just gotta be patient when patting it cause it takes a while to absorb. Other than that, it's gentle and effective, it didn't cause any reactions and it left my eyes fresh and nice ^^

I would totally recommend this to anyone who wants something light and plain, but I wouldn't buy it again. Mainly cause there are so many eye creams out there to try out so I can't wait to finish this :D I wouldn't recommend it if you are really impatient or if you are looking for something to treat more specific problems. If you are young and you are starting now to use eye creams, this would be nice for you.
